Vector Boson Fusion (VBF) tagging is an interesting
and promising new avenue to probe difficult models such as the compressed electroweak and
colored spectra scenarios in supersymmetry (SUSY). A search of SUSY using the VBF topology is presented using 19.7 fb-1
of data from pp collisions at 8 TeV collected by the CMS detector. Focus is placed on SUSY models that have significant branching fractions to leptons, resulting in final states with at least two
reconstructed leptons with like-sign or opposite-sign electric charge. The number of observed events
are consistent with the standard model expectations. Limits on the chargino and neutralino masses at
95 % confidence level are set.
